You would most likely need to contact the National Archives but the following may help.
As for the number:
Officers Cooks and Stewards:
UPPER PAY SCALE PRE 25th October 1925
[Those already serving]
L......to L15101.
   
LOWER PAY SCALE POST 25th October 1925
[Those joining on or after this date]
LX commencing with 20001
